Crockpot Tortellini Soup with Chicken is the perfect dish to warm your soul on chilly nights or busy weeknights. This hearty soup combines flavorful chicken sausage, tender cheese tortellini, and vibrant fresh spinach, all simmered slowly in a rich tomato broth. With minimal preparation time and the convenience of a slow cooker, this recipe is ideal for family gatherings or cozy dinners at home. Ingredients

Scale
  • 16 ounces chicken sausage
  • 1/2 medium onion (chopped)
  • 4 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 2 medium carrots (sliced)
  • 2 sticks celery (chopped)
  • 1 (28 ounce) can crushed tomatoes
  • 1 (14 ounce) can diced tomatoes
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• 2 (9 ounce) packages refrigerated cheese tortellini
  • 3/4 cup heavy cream (optional)
  • 2 cups fresh baby spinach
  • Salt & pepper (to taste)

Instructions

  1. In a skillet, brown the chicken sausage and onions over medium heat for about 7-8 minutes until cooked through. Add minced garlic and sauté for an additional 30 seconds.
  2. Transfer the sausage mixture to a Crockpot and add chopped carrots, celery, crushed tomatoes, diced tomatoes, and chicken broth.
  3. Cook on high for 4-5 hours or low for 7-8 hours.
  4. About 30 minutes before serving, stir in the cheese tortellini, heavy cream if using, and fresh spinach.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
